目前过磷酸钙肥料供不应求,因此有些生产队把磷矿石粉碎后直接下地,效果很低或者不增产。也有些县、社、队利用废硫酸土法制磷肥,由于废硫酸来源有限,以及加工技术不过关等原因,制出的磷肥质量不高。我们试验利用氧化硫硫杆菌转化磷矿粉,取得较好的效果。从自然界中分离到的氧化硫硫杆菌,在一定条件下能够利用硫磺或其它硫磺
